Beginning her fourth year in Huntsville, Robin Hubbard previously served as assistant women’s tennis coach at University of Maryland-Baltimore County before joining the Sam Houston State staff.

She brings a wealth of teaching experience to the Bearkats, having also been an assistant coach at Towson State and Texas-Pan American. She also has worked as a tennis professional at four top tennis clubs in Texas.

She was a pro at the Forty West Racquet Club for six years, had a one-year stint at The Club at Cimarron in Misson and was the director of junior tennis at the Walden Racquet Club in Conroe. She also was a member of the pro staff at the Del Lago Tennis Resort Center and April Sound Tennis Club, both in Conroe, for close to a decade.
Hubbard played college tennis at the University of North Texas in Denton. She was the No. 1 singles player for UNT’s No. 14 nationally ranked squad and ranked among the top 50 in the women’s rankings.

The Dallas native played on the Virginia Slims pro tour from 1979 to 1981.

Before college, Hubbard was ranked No. 64 in the nation in Girls 18’s, No. 5 in Texas and was ranked No. 1 in Texas Open Mixed Doubles.
